Vehicle Description
This 1967 Jaguar XKE fixed-head coupe underwent a complete cosmetic
and mechanical restoration, and starts, idles, runs and drives
well. It has been driven less than 1,000 miles since the
restoration. This matching-numbers Series 1 is powered by a
4.2-liter V6 engine mated to a 4-speed manual transmission. It is
equipped with triple carburetors, synchronized first gear, wire
wheels and covered headlights. It is one of 4,249 Series 1 LHD
fixed-head coupes that were built in their six year run. During
restoration, this Jaguar received a new windshield, new black
interior, new ceramic header, new stainless exhaust and new wire
wheels and tires. The entire drivetrain was rebuilt including an
all-new cooling system, the radio was replaced with a
vintage-appearing modern unit and the exterior color was changed
from white to red.
